Pass Criteria

Pass criteria define the thresholds for evaluation decisions. They control how findings and category results translate to pass/fail outcomes.

PassCriteria Structure

type PassCriteria struct {
    MinCategoriesPassing string        `json:"minCategoriesPassing"` // "all", "all_required", or number
    MaxFindings          *FindingLimits `json:"maxFindingsSeverity"`  // Max findings by severity
    MinIntScore          IntegerScore  `json:"minIntScore"`          // Minimum overall score (1-5)
}

type FindingLimits struct {
    Critical int `json:"critical"` // Max critical findings (-1 = unlimited)
    High     int `json:"high"`     // Max high findings (-1 = unlimited)
    Medium   int `json:"medium"`   // Max medium findings (-1 = unlimited)
    Low      int `json:"low"`      // Max low findings (-1 = unlimited)
}

Default Criteria

func DefaultPassCriteria() PassCriteria {
    return PassCriteria{
        MinCategoriesPassing: "all_required",
        MaxFindings: &FindingLimits{
            Critical: 0,  // No critical findings allowed
            High:     0,  // No high findings allowed
            Medium:   -1, // Unlimited medium findings
            Low:      -1, // Unlimited low findings
        },
    }
}

With default criteria:

  • ❌ Any critical finding → Fail
  • ❌ Any high finding → Fail
  • ✅ Medium/low/info findings → Allowed
  • ✅ Partial categories → Allowed (if not required)

Decision Status

Based on criteria evaluation:

const (
    DecisionPass        DecisionStatus = "pass"         // All criteria met
    DecisionFail        DecisionStatus = "fail"         // Blocking issues found
    DecisionConditional DecisionStatus = "conditional"  // Partial pass, needs attention
    DecisionHumanReview DecisionStatus = "human_review" // Uncertain, needs human review
)

Decision Logic

// Pseudocode for decision computation
func computeDecision(report *Rubric, criteria PassCriteria) Decision {
    counts := report.Decision.FindingCounts
    catCounts := report.Decision.CategoryCounts

    // Check blocking findings
    if counts.Critical > criteria.MaxCritical {
        return Decision{Status: DecisionFail, Rationale: "Too many critical findings"}
    }
    if counts.High > criteria.MaxHigh {
        return Decision{Status: DecisionFail, Rationale: "Too many high findings"}
    }
    if criteria.MaxMedium >= 0 && counts.Medium > criteria.MaxMedium {
        return Decision{Status: DecisionFail, Rationale: "Too many medium findings"}
    }

    // Check category requirements
    if criteria.RequireAllPass && catCounts.Fail > 0 {
        return Decision{Status: DecisionFail, Rationale: "Some categories failed"}
    }
    if criteria.RequireAllPass && catCounts.Partial > 0 {
        return Decision{Status: DecisionConditional, Rationale: "Some categories partial"}
    }

    // All checks passed
    if catCounts.Fail == 0 && catCounts.Partial == 0 {
        return Decision{Status: DecisionPass}
    }

    return Decision{Status: DecisionConditional}
}

MinIntScore (v0.9.0)

Require a minimum overall integer score (1-5) for approval:

criteria := rubric.PassCriteria{
    MinCategoriesPassing: "all_required",
    MaxFindings: &rubric.FindingLimits{
        Critical: 0,
        High:     0,
        Medium:   -1,
        Low:      -1,
    },
    MinIntScore: rubric.ScoreGood,  // Require 4+ overall
}

report.SetPassCriteria(criteria)
report.Evaluate(rubricSet)

// If computed IntScore < 4, report.Pass = false

Use Cases

// Quality gate - require "Good" (4) or better
criteria.MinIntScore = rubric.ScoreGood

// Strict gate - require "Excellent" (5)
criteria.MinIntScore = rubric.ScoreExcellent

// Minimum viable - require "Acceptable" (3) or better
criteria.MinIntScore = rubric.ScoreAcceptable

Combined with Finding Limits

MinIntScore is checked after IntScore is computed:

// Both must pass:
// 1. No critical/high findings
// 2. Overall score >= 4
criteria := rubric.PassCriteria{
    MaxFindings: &rubric.FindingLimits{Critical: 0, High: 0, Medium: -1, Low: -1},
    MinIntScore: rubric.ScoreGood,
}

Definition Pass Criteria vs. Report Pass Criteria

There are two related types:

  • PassCriteria (above) lives on an evaluation report (Rubric) and drives its pass/fail outcome.
  • RubricPassCriteria lives on a rubric definition (RubricSet) and is authored alongside the categories.
type RubricPassCriteria struct {
    MinCategoriesPassing string           `json:"minCategoriesPassing,omitempty"`
    MaxFindings          *FindingLimits   `json:"maxFindingsSeverity,omitempty"`
    ScoreThresholds      *ScoreThresholds `json:"scoreThresholds,omitempty"`
}

Score Thresholds (v0.10.0)

For rich rubrics — where categories and criteria carry weights and the overall score is a weighted roll-up (0-100) — ScoreThresholds sets the numeric pass/partial cutoffs:

type ScoreThresholds struct {
    Pass    int `json:"pass"`    // e.g. 80 — score >= 80 passes
    Partial int `json:"partial"` // e.g. 60 — score >= 60 is partial
}
passCriteria:
  scoreThresholds: {pass: 80, partial: 60}
